Union Grove High School baseball team secured an 11-8 victory over Waterford in a high-scoring Southern Lakes Conference showdown, with key performances from Weist and Dessart.

By the Numbers
  • Union Grove had three three-run innings.
  • Waterford committed seven errors and eight walks.

State of Play
  • Union Grove (4-4, 1-2 SLC) triumphed over Waterford (0-5, 0-3 SLC).
  • Waterford's struggles included errors and walks, hindering their performance.
  • Union Grove capitalized on key moments to secure the victory.
